 "The Powers of Dignity uncovers and analyzes the distinctively Black political philosophy that Frederick Douglass forged from his experience as an enslaved and later nominally free black man. Because he unwaveringly viewed politics and democracy from the standpoint of a racialized black subject, his philosophy both challenges and potentially transforms the Anglo-Continental tradition of political thought"--
